The "MP4" container format itself is a versatile digital vessel, capable of holding video, audio, and subtitles. Its popularity stems from its wide compatibility across devices and platforms. However, the "p" in "2160p," "1080p," "720p," "480p," and "360p" refers to progressive scan, indicating the vertical resolution of the video. The number represents the number of horizontal lines of pixels that make up the image. Higher numbers equal greater detail and sharper images, but they also mean larger file sizes and more processing power required for playback. Choosing the right resolution is a balancing act between visual quality, storage space, and the capabilities of your playback device.

MP4 2160p (4K): This represents the apex of home entertainment resolution, boasting a staggering 3840 x 2160 pixels. The "4K" designation is often used interchangeably, though it can also refer to slightly different resolutions in cinema. The sheer density of pixels in 4K renders images with breathtaking clarity, allowing viewers to discern the finest details, from individual strands of hair to the textures of clothing. This is ideal for watching on large screens, where the immersive experience is truly amplified. However, 4K files are significantly larger than their lower-resolution counterparts, demanding substantial storage space and potentially taxing your internet bandwidth for streaming.
MP4 1080p (Full HD): Often regarded as the standard for high-definition content, 1080p, or Full HD, offers a resolution of 1920 x 1080 pixels. This is a substantial leap in quality from older formats, providing sharp, detailed images that are perfectly suited for most modern TVs and monitors. 1080p strikes a good balance between visual quality and file size, making it a popular choice for both streaming and physical media such as Blu-ray discs. It remains the dominant resolution for much of the content available today.
MP4 720p (HD): This resolution, at 1280 x 720 pixels, still qualifies as high definition, although it's a step down from 1080p. 720p is a solid option for smaller screens and can be advantageous for users with limited bandwidth or storage capacity. While not as visually striking as 1080p or 4K, 720p still provides a noticeable improvement over older standard-definition formats. It's often the go-to choice for content streamed on mobile devices or older computers.
MP4 480p (SD): Representing standard definition, 480p offers a resolution of 854 x 480 pixels. This resolution is most often found on DVDs and older streaming services. While it lacks the crispness of higher resolutions, 480p remains a viable option, particularly for older devices or for those with very limited internet speeds. It provides a viewable experience without requiring a lot of bandwidth or storage space.
MP4 360p: At 640 x 360 pixels, 360p is the lowest common denominator for video resolution. This format is primarily for when you are streaming from a slow internet connection or limited mobile data. While it may appear blocky or pixelated on modern displays, it is still an option for users with constrained resources, offering watchable video experiences.

Beyond resolution, understanding other factors related to MP4 files is crucial for optimal viewing. One of the most important is the codec. A codec is a piece of software or hardware that compresses and decompresses digital media files, like video. The most common codec for MP4 files is H.264 (also known as AVC), which offers a good balance between compression efficiency and quality. However, newer codecs, such as H.265 (also known as HEVC) are becoming more popular, offering even greater compression rates which are especially useful for higher-resolution content, while still maintaining the same quality and thus providing smaller file sizes. When selecting your media, always be aware of the codec that is used.
Bitrate is another key factor. The bitrate of a video file refers to the amount of data used to encode one second of video or audio. Its usually measured in megabits per second (Mbps). A higher bitrate generally means better quality, but it also means a larger file size. For example, a 4K video might have a bitrate of 20-40 Mbps or higher, while a 720p video might have a bitrate of 2-5 Mbps. When downloading or streaming video, consider your bandwidth capabilities. If you have a slow internet connection, you'll likely want to choose videos with a lower bitrate to avoid buffering and playback issues.
Frame rate, measured in frames per second (fps), affects how smoothly the video appears to your eye. Most movies are filmed at 24 fps, which creates a cinematic look. Video games and other content that benefit from faster movement often use 30 or 60 fps. Higher frame rates generally produce a smoother and more natural-looking motion, particularly in scenes with rapid movement. The ideal frame rate also depends on the type of content you are viewing, and the capabilities of your viewing device.
Audio quality, often overlooked, is another essential element of the viewing experience. MP4 files can carry various audio tracks encoded with different codecs. Commonly used audio codecs include AAC (Advanced Audio Coding), which is the standard for many streaming services, and MP3, a widely compatible codec. Ensure that the audio quality is appropriate for the video. Lower resolutions may do well with less audio, but for higher resolutions, higher-quality audio tracks will lead to a more immersive experience.

Playback devices can significantly impact how you experience video. While most modern devices, including smartphones, tablets, smart TVs, and computers, can play MP4 files, the quality of the display and the processing power of the device will influence the overall experience. A 4K video will appear best on a 4K-compatible screen, while the experience on a smaller screen might not be as discernible. Check your hardware for compatibility when you get your device.
For streaming, your internet connection is the primary factor. Streaming services automatically adjust the resolution based on your internet speed. However, you might be able to manually adjust the resolution settings in the app to suit your needs. A slower connection might force you to watch at 360p or 480p, while a high-speed connection will let you stream at 1080p or even 4K. The ideal option here is to know your connection's limitations and adjust accordingly.
Storage space is an equally important consideration. Higher-resolution videos require more storage. If you plan to download a large library of movies and TV shows, consider the storage capacity of your device. Using external hard drives or cloud storage solutions can help manage your media files efficiently.
Software and player applications also affect playback. Some media players offer better support for specific codecs or features, such as HDR (High Dynamic Range), which enhances the brightness and color range of the video. Experiment with different players, such as VLC media player, to find one that suits your needs and offers the best playback experience. Most devices come with native player software. However, choosing third-party software allows users to customize playback to their liking, whether it is audio settings, video settings, or subtitle settings.
